We use Confluence On Demand and I am unable to delete any pages. I'm a member of the following groups:
administrators
confluence-users
site-admins
users
But there is no UI whatsoever to delete a page, or even to delete a page version. What am I missing?

To check for the given permissions, you can take a look at *Confluence Admin > Global Permission* and check which permissions is given to each user. In example, remove, edit, add.
In case of still not having it, but, the user already in the permitted groups, I suggest you to raise a new ticket with our support team, through https://support.atlassian.com
